Output 80288bc84ba15b006fd293433a3f2066ab84e3ad8998a8e0d4cce9ea52fc878b:3

value
66778870
script pubkey
OP_0 OP_PUSHBYTES_20 fce1f632536e96cec6154be53dfe848d61086d81
address
ltc1qlnslvvjnd6tva3s4f0jnml5y34sssmvpg4fufp
transaction
80288bc84ba15b006fd293433a3f2066ab84e3ad8998a8e0d4cce9ea52fc878b
spent
true